								Alexander Kornienko
							
						 
						
							 
							
							
							
							
								
							
							
								c121b9b796 
								
							 
						 
						
							
							
								
								-Wimplicit-fallthrough: fixed two cases where "fallthrough annotation in unreachable code" was issued incorrectly.  
							
							 
							
							... 
							
							
							
							Summary:
-Wimplicit-fallthrough: fixed two cases where "fallthrough annotation in unreachable code" was issued incorrectly:
1. In actual unreachable code, but not immediately on a fall-through execution
path "fallthrough annotation does not directly precede switch label" is better;
2. After default: in a switch with covered enum cases. Actually, these shouldn't
be treated as unreachable code for our purpose.

								Alexander Kornienko
							
						 
						
							 
							
							
							
							
								
							
							
								afed1ddb40 
								
							 
						 
						
							
							
								
								Don't warn on fall-through from unreachable code.  
							
							 
							
							... 
							
							
							
							Summary:
A motivating example:
class ClassWithDtor {
public:
  ~ClassWithDtor() {}
};
void fallthrough3(int n) {
  switch (n) {
    case 2:
      do {
        ClassWithDtor temp;
        return;
      } while (0);  // This generates a chain of unreachable CFG blocks.
    case 3:
      break;
  }
}

								Alexander Kornienko
							
						 
						
							 
							
							
							
							
								
							
							
								09f15f3edf 
								
							 
						 
						
							
							
								
								Silence unintended fallthrough diagnostic on a case label preceded with a normal label.  
							
							 
							
							... 
							
							
							
							Summary:
It's unlikely that a fallthrough is unintended in the following code:
switch (n) {
...
  label:
  case 1:
...
    goto label;
...
}

								Richard Smith
							
						 
						
							 
							
							
							
							
								
							
							
								84837d5b5a 
								
							 
						 
						
							
							
								
								Add -Wimplicit-fallthrough warning flag, which warns on fallthrough between  
							
							 
							
							... 
							
							
							
							cases in switch statements. Also add a [[clang::fallthrough]] attribute, which
can be used to suppress the warning in the case of intentional fallthrough.
Patch by Alexander Kornienko!
The handling of C++11 attribute namespaces in this patch is temporary, and will
be replaced with a cleaner mechanism in a subsequent patch.
